When you run a Microsoft Office XP program, the file Ctfmon.exe (Ctfmon) runs in the background, even after you quit all Office programs.
Ctfmon.exe monitors the active windows and provides text input service support for speech recognition, handwriting recognition, keyboard, translation, and other alternative user input technologies.
you can learn more about this file an how to uninstall it on this link - *support.microsoft.com/default.aspx?scid=kb;EN-US;q282599

BTW i browsed some of the famous web sites for this file and in some cases i found out that if this file is outside c:/windows/system 32 folder then it can be a virus....so jus check its locatin also...

Process File: ctfmon or ctfmon.exe
Process Name: Alternative User Input Services
 
Description:
ctfmon.exe is a part of the Microsoft Office suite. It activates the Alternative User Input Text Input Processor (TIP) and the Microsoft Office XP Language Bar. This program is a non-essential system process, but should not be terminated unless suspected to be causing problems.
